Overview
The consultant will conduct an audit of health-sector statistical reports to assess their legal basis, relevance, and actual use, and develop a streamlined reporting set with harmonized definitions and digitalization options.
Key Responsibilities
- Conduct a desk review including legal and technical analysis of reporting forms against legislation, data sources, and information needs.
- Conduct targeted consultations with subject-matter experts to validate findings.
- Develop an analytical report with consolidated recommendations to maintain, revise, merge, or discontinue specific forms and indicators.
